The Minnesota Wild (5-4-1), one of the NHL’s top power play offenses, host the Seattle Kraken (5-4-2) and their weak penalty killing defense at Xcel Energy Center on Thursday. Seattle is coming off a high-scoring 5-4 win over the Flames on Tuesday. The Kraken committed five penalties in the game, though they held Calgary without a power play goal.

Five players found the net for the Kraken. Oliver Bjorkstrand had two assists to lead the team in scoring. Joey Daccord only saved 36 of 40 shots (.900%) in the win. Minnesota beat the Canadiens 4-1 on Tuesday. Kirill Kaprizov was the leading goal scorer for the Wild, netting twice. Marc-Andre Fleury saved 34 of 35 shots in the win (.971%).

HEAD TO HEAD

The Wild won two of the three games between the teams last season, including a 6-3 victory in their final meeting in April. Kevin Fiala led Minnesota with five points (0G 5A). Jared McCann led Seattle with two points (0G 2A). Fleury got the win despite allowing three goals on 28 shots (.892%).

FACING OFF

Seattle is averaging 3.45 goals per game for the season, 10th in the NHL, and they are taking on a Wild team that is allowing 3.60 goals a game (26th). Meanwhile, Minnesota has found the net 3.40 times a game on average, 11th in the league, and the Kraken are allowing opponents to score 3.45 goals per game (22nd).

Power play opportunities should be plentiful for the Kraken, as the Wild have been penalized 5.30 times a game, fourth-most in the NHL, for an average of 13.40 minutes (third-highest). The visitors are averaging 4.18 penalties (21st) and 10.64 penalty minutes a game (12th).

The Wild will be looking to build on their fourth-ranked power play percentage of 28.57% against the Kraken, who are the league’s fourth-weakest penalty killing team (70.27%). Seattle, meanwhile, has scored on 26.83% of their power play opportunities (6th), which the away team will be aiming to improve on against Minnesota’s 24th-ranked 75.00% penalty killing rate.

TOP PERFORMERS:

With 10 points this season, Jaden Schwartz is the top skater for the Kraken. He has five goals and five assists in 11 games. In the net, Martin Jones (4-3-1) is Seattle’s top goaltender by goals against average. He has a 3.09 GAA and a .879% save percentage.

Kaprizov and Mats Zuccarello lead the Wild in scoring with 13 and 12 points, respectively. Kaprizov has eight goals (8th) and five assists, while Zuccarello has five goals and seven assists in 10 games. Fleury (4-1-1) has the best goals against average for Minnesota at 3.69. He has a save percentage of .880%.

HOME AND AWAY

Seattle is 3-1-1 away from home this season. Minnesota is 2-3-0 at home this season.
